1994 Alfa Romeo 33 vs. 1974 BMW 1502

To start off, 1994 Alfa Romeo 33 is newer by 20 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1974 BMW 1502.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1974 BMW 1502 would be higher. At 1,574 cc (4 cylinders), 1974 BMW 1502 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1994 Alfa Romeo 33 (87 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 4 more horse power than 1974 BMW 1502. (83 HP @ 5800 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1994 Alfa Romeo 33 should accelerate faster than 1974 BMW 1502.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1994 Alfa Romeo 33 weights approximately 10 kg more than 1974 BMW 1502.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 1974 BMW 1502 (130 Nm @ 3500 RPM) has 6 more torque (in Nm) than 1994 Alfa Romeo 33. (124 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 1974 BMW 1502 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1994 Alfa Romeo 33.
